LCII Hedge Fund Activity: Q4 2013 in Review

153 of the 3,445 institutional investors tracked by Wall St. Rank reported a position in LCI Industries (LCII) for Q4 2013, worth a combined $1.11B — up 11% from $1B a quarter earlier.

Buyers outnumbered sellers: 23 funds opened new LCII positions and 9 closed out — a net gain of 14 holders — while 63 added to existing stakes and 54 trimmed.

The largest buyer was Loomis, Sayles & Company, adding an estimated $17.6M. The largest seller was EdgePoint Investment Group, cutting an estimated $29.9M.
